Moultrie-Douglas Contestants



News Progress


New royalty to be crowned
The Moultrie-Douglas County Fair Pageant will be held Monday, July 27th at 6:00 p.m. for Little Miss Fair Queen and 7:00 p.m. for Miss and Junior Miss Fair Queen located at the south track on the Mo-Do Fairgrounds. Vying for the title of Miss Moultrie Douglas Fair Queen are: Abigail Meyer of Tuscola, Addee Mulligan of Arcola, Sarah Rogers of Atwood, Ava Whitson of Tuscola, Addisyn Wilson of Villa Grove, Emma Spillman of Tuscola, Aymara Leal of Arcola and Katilyn Kirby of Sullivan.

Jr Miss Moultrie-Douglas contestants
Vying for the title of Jr Miss Moultrie-Douglas are: Harper Hale of Arthur, Brooklyn Bates of Sullivan, Sofie Reifsteck of Tuscola, Sophia Wilson of Arcola, Miley Rennels of Tuscola, Ava Warren of Sullivan, Tatum Faust of Pesotum, Maggie Meyer of Tuscola and Audrey Warren of Sullivan, pictured 2025 Jr Miss Moultrie-Douglas Quinn Chapman of Villa Grove.
Little Miss Moultrie-Douglas contestants
Vying for the title of Little Miss Moultrie-Douglas are: Everleigh Allen of Tuscola, Emelia Shelmadine of Tuscola, Arabella Butterick of Arthur, Josslyn Leigh Brown of Sullivan, Athalia Juliet Sanchez of Arcola, Myla Ro Oye of Arthur, Sophie Elliott of Sullivan, Rosie Smith of Villa Grove, Tinley Eads of Arthur, Alayna Guadiana of Arcola and Alexandria Brackemyre of Lovington, pictured with 2025 Little Miss Moultrie-Douglas Joslynn Steffens of Tuscola.
